## Deploying the Gatewick Proctor Queue

Deploys are pretty painless: push to main, wait for the pipeline, then watch the queue drain dashboard for five minutes. If candidates pile up mid-exam, roll back first and ask questions later — the queue replays safely. Everything the workers care about lives in one config block, shown here for reference.

settings of bafof-yagef:
JOROX_PIN=8740
JOROX_TENANT=pelox
JOROX_METRICS_HOST=metrics.jorox.qorvelworks.internal
JOROX_SEAL=seal_c78f63c1
JOROX_STANDBY_TEAM=norax

### Token Refresh Weirdness

If users of Fernwick start getting bounced to the login screen every few minutes, you've probably hit the refresh race again. Two refresh calls land at once, the second invalidates the first, and the session dies. Quick fix: bump the grace window in the auth config and restart the token service. Don't touch the signing keys. Full steps and config values live on the internal page below.

runbook for badug-kadup: https://confluence.zemvarlabs.internal/projects/browse/display/projects/bd1b

Subject: Scheduled key rotation — Slimforge pipeline

Maintainers,

As part of routine hygiene, we are rotating the API key used by Slimforge, our internal container image slimming service, on the first of next month. The old key remains valid for a seven-day grace window; after that, builds will fail at the slimming stage. The replacement key is provided below.

service key, bajef-tahog: vxb2-ux

Step 4: Deploying the Ledgerline CSV import wizard. Build the wizard bundle, push to staging, and confirm the column-mapping preview loads. Support handles customer retries; failed rows land in the review queue. The wizard signs upload URLs using a credential from the app env file, so before restarting the service, append the following line.

vault entry, yahif-yajep: COURIER_KEY29=b802bdf8034096b65a51c6ba5abe2

Subject: VRAM profiler cut-over complete

Cut-over to Gaugestone v2 finished last night. Old allocator hooks removed, sampling agent deployed fleet-wide, no regressions in the Bellhaven test rigs. One straggler node re-imaged this morning. Dashboards are live. For the release notes, the production configuration now in effect is the following.

service settings:
PRAIX_LOG_LEVEL=error
PRAIX_METRICS_HOST=metrics.praix.qorvelcorp.corp
PRAIX_POOL_SIZE=16